Twenty Qualifying Heats packed Saturday, 5th May, in a good sporting atmosphere under the sun at Salbris (FRA). Kobe Pauwels in Academy, Jorrit Pex in KZ and Riccardo Longhi in KZ2 were the strongmen of the day. The Qualifying phase will continue on Sunday morning with six heats on the programme, one for each of the Drivers, and as many possibilities of upheaval, before we will know the list of the 34 finalists in each category.

The no8 Toyota Gazoo Racing trio of Fernando Alonso, Kazuki Nakajima and Sebastien Buemi got their 2018/19 Super Season title challenge off to a perfect start with a lights to flag victory to claim maximum points at the Total 6 Hours of Spa-Francorchamps. Alonso brought the TS050-hybrid home just 1.4 seconds ahead of the no7 Toyota driven by Mike Conway after a last hour safety car eroded the Spanish driver’s large lead.

Toyota Gazoo Racing start from front-row of grid for Total 6 Hours of Spa-Francorchamps. The no7 Toyota of Kamui Kobayashi and Mike Conway set a combined average lap of 1m54.488s to grab pole position. However all of the times were subsequently cancelled after the Fuel Flow Meter was incorrectly declared (Stewards Decision no14) and the no7 TS050 will start the race from the pitlane.
